A sewage ejector pump failure in a Maysville home with below-grade bathrooms creates a backup situation faster than a typical drain clog โ because the pump is the only thing moving sewage from those fixtures up to the main sewer line. When a sewage ejector pump fails, the pit fills and sewage has nowhere to go. Stop using all below-grade fixtures immediately and call us. We stock sewage ejector pumps for Chaffee County emergency installations, and in most cases can have a replacement operational the same day. Chemical drain cleaners are the first thing most Maysville homeowners try โ and they create additional problems more often than they solve the one they're treating. Caustic drain chemicals generate heat as they work, which can soften or warp PVC fittings. In older homes in Chaffee County with cast iron or galvanized drain lines, repeated chemical treatments accelerate corrosion. And because store-bought drain cleaners rarely reach the full blockage in a partially clogged line, they sit in the standing water above the clog and do more damage to the pipe walls than to the clog itself. If a drain is consistently slow, a plumber with a snake or a hydro jet addresses the actual blockage.

After a power outage in Maysville, electric water heaters require a simple reset to resume normal operation โ the high-temperature cutoff switch may have tripped during the power event. The reset button is typically accessible through a panel on the side of the unit; pressing it after confirming power has been restored is often all that's needed. Gas water heaters with electronic ignition may need the pilot relit after the outage. If the unit doesn't return to normal operation after a reset attempt, or if it trips repeatedly during normal operation in your Chaffee County home, the cutoff is responding to an actual temperature or element issue that requires professional diagnosis.

Sewer line repairs in Maysville start with a camera โ always. We don't recommend excavation based on symptoms alone because the same symptom (slow main drain) can indicate root intrusion, grease accumulation, a pipe sag holding standing water, or a collapsed section. Each requires a different approach. Camera inspection narrows it to the correct diagnosis before any repair decision is made. Trenchless lining is available for lines where the pipe wall is intact but infiltrated; replacement is recommended where the structural condition warrants it.

Most outdoor hose bibs installed in Maysville homes in the last 25 years have an integral or add-on vacuum breaker โ a small backflow prevention device that prevents contaminated outdoor water from being siphoned back into the potable supply when a hose is left connected with the faucet closed. These vacuum breakers have a limited service life and can fail in either direction: stuck closed (reducing flow to a trickle) or stuck open (constantly dripping). We check hose bib vacuum breaker condition during Chaffee County maintenance visits โ a $5 replacement prevents both the nuisance of restricted outdoor flow and the code compliance issue of a non-functioning backflow device.
